A victimless crime refers to an illegal act that does not directly damage or infringe upon the rights of another person. These offenses often consist of consensual actions among adults or conduct that is self-guided.
The phrase suggests that there isn’t a clear victim affected by the action, though society at large or indirect parties could be seen as possible “victims” depending on the situation. For instance: Wagering on games of chance without proper legal permission, Utilizing or owning illegal drugs.
In Dubai and the wider United Arab Emirates (UAE), the legal system does not clearly acknowledge the idea of victimless crimes. The UAE Penal Code classifies criminal offenses according to the seriousness of their penalties.
